Study Notes

  • Standards in construction refer to published documents defining specifications, methods, and procedures.
  • Standard specifications cover quality of materials, products, and components.
  • Standard test methods determine product or system performance through testing.
  • Standard methods of practice include specific fabrication, installation, and maintenance methods.
  • Key US standards organizations include ANSI, ASTM, and UL.
  • CUBIC is a uniform building code for English-speaking Caribbean islands.
  • CUBIC standards require hurricane and earthquake resistance.
  • Maximum allowable building area and height are determined by building code.
  • Allowable area and height depend on building occupancy, type of construction, width of open spaces, and sprinkler systems.
  • UL covers safety and hazard testing and certification for various industries.
